Suffolk GC was built in 1952 by Dick Wilson. This old course will test every club in your bag. It is an old fashioned tree lined course that plays longer than the yardage with the elavation change and doglegs that need to be negotiated. The back nine views are beautiful with many of the holes having Lake Kilby in play. If your lucky enough, you might catch a view of the bald eagle on hole 12. The greens are bent grass and the fairways are bermuda.
